OkHttpClient okHttpClient = new OkHttpClient.Builder() .connectTimeo ...
為什么要使用ip直連這種方式去請求我們的服務器呢 這其實和國內運營傷有關,運營商有時為了利益會將你的域名劫持換成他人的域名,為了防止這種情況的發生通用的解決辦法要么聯系運營商要么就只能使用ip直連了。普遍大家目前使用的都是okHttp,這里就以okHttp為例子。其實非常簡單只需要設置一下兩個方法就行: 通過調用sslSocketFactory 方法傳入兩個參數一個是:SSLSocket,還有一 ...
2019-04-13 16:44 0 1356 推薦指數:
OkHttpClient okHttpClient = new OkHttpClient.Builder() .connectTimeo ...
不ok了,具體情況如下 [root@host tmp]# wget https://cdn.ex ...
下面這個 TLSv1.2 的 基於 RSA 算法的四次握手過程 不過 TLS 握手過程的次數還得看版本。TLSv1.2 握手過程基本都是需要四次,也就是需要經過 2-RTT 才能完成握手,然后才能發送請求,而 TLSv1.3 只需要 1-RTT 就能完成 ...
Https系列會在下面幾篇文章中分別作介紹: 一:https的簡單介紹及SSL證書的生成二:https的SSL證書在服務器端的部署,基於tomcat,spring boot三:讓服務器同時支持http、https,基於spring boot四:https的SSL證書在Android端 ...
通過使用Wireshark抓包分析TLS握手的過程,可以更容易理解和驗證TLS協議,本文將先介紹Wireshark解密HTTPS流量的方法,然后分別驗證TLS握手過程和TLS會話恢復的過程。 一、使用Wireshark解密HTTPS流量的方法 TLS對傳輸數據進行了加密,直接使用 ...
先記錄下大概流程 1、使用Okhttp發送post請求到服務端完成注冊登錄 2、添加https,實現https請求 3、遇到的問題:post請求多次發送造成后端數據不在同一session,解決:OkHttpClient創建時,傳入這個CookieJar的實現,就能完成對Cookie的自動管理 ...
這幾天測試打印機一直出現打印延遲或者不打印的BUG。找了幾天也沒有發現為啥沒有打印或者打印延遲。然后今天公司的研發大佬過來找問題,並開個會,瞬間所有的問題都找出了並且知道怎么解決了。大佬果然還是大佬。佩服實在是佩服!!! 現在這個社會,我們都離不開網絡,那么網絡的工作流程是怎么樣 ...
1,客戶端輸入https網址,鏈接到server443端口; 2,服務器手中有一把鑰匙和一個鎖頭,把鎖頭傳遞給客戶端。數字證書既是公鑰,又是鎖頭 3,客戶端拿到鎖頭后,生成一個隨機數,用鎖頭把隨機數鎖起來(加密),再傳遞給服務器。這個隨機數成為私鑰,現在只有客戶端知道 4,服務器用鑰匙打開 ...